Hi everyone,
Caught a few keeper Black Drum and Sheepshead the other day. I usually saute them with a little Salt, Pepper, Onion and Garlic powder. Anyone have other suggestions?
Thanks
Paul
Ppatti1111: You have caught some fine eating fish. We usually fry them. But what you are doing sounds fine. Just Sayin...RJS
I have made tacos from them. I Bar B Q them in foil. Season with a little salt & pepper and heavy on the chilli powder. Throw some cilantro pinch of lime on corn tortillas with the fish and a cold cevaza. Very tasty, easy and healthy.....sorta LOL!
